Onboarding note for security review: the Scanlith barcode integration. The scanner bridge runs as a sandboxed local service that forwards decoded barcode payloads to the inventory API over mutual TLS. Payloads are validated against an allowlist of symbologies before parsing, and raw frames are never persisted. Audit logging covers every decode event. The threat model and data-flow diagrams are maintained on the internal page below.

operations page: https://jenkins.zemvarcloud.local/job/merge_requests/repo/build/73930b4b30f0a8ed

Every image uploaded through Lanternbox passes through the ScrubStage before it touches persistent storage. The stage strips GPS coordinates, device serials, and maker notes, but deliberately preserves orientation and color-profile tags so thumbnails render correctly. If you add a new upload path, you must wire it through ScrubStage — there is no global safety net, and bypassing it has caused privacy incidents before. The full tag allowlist, test fixtures, and rationale for each preserved field are documented on the internal wiki page.

runbook for tafof-yawif: https://confluence.tolvaqsys.internal/display/display/browse/pages/7be3

Finance Review Summary — Selwick Group, for the Board

Hiring freeze in the Logistics division held firm this quarter. Payroll savings tracking 6% ahead of target. Attrition at 9%, within tolerance; two critical roles backfilled via internal transfer. Service levels stable. Recommend extending the freeze one further quarter, review in March. No exceptions granted. Context on forward plans is set out below.

board note of tahog-kajep: Wenionix Holdings plans to raise the Praion list price by 34 percent in December.